在编程和数据分析中,生成随机数是一个非常常见的需求。无论是模拟实验、游戏开发还是加密技术,随机数都是不可或缺的一部分。今天,我将为大家介绍两种生成随机数的方法,帮助大家更好地理解和使用它们。
方法一:使用内置函数
大多数编程语言都提供了生成随机数的内置函数。例如,在Python中,我们可以使用`random`模块来实现。下面是一个简单的例子:
```python
import random
number = random.randint(1, 100)
print("随机数是:" + str(number))
```
这个例子会生成一个1到100之间的随机整数。通过这种方式,我们可以快速地生成随机数,非常适合日常使用。
方法二:使用外部库
除了内置函数外,我们还可以使用一些专门的库来生成更高质量的随机数。例如,`numpy`库提供了一个更强大的随机数生成功能。下面是一个使用`numpy`的例子:
```python
import numpy as np
number = np.random.randint(1, 100)
print("随机数是:" + str(number))
```
这种方法可以生成更大范围内的随机数,并且具有更好的随机性,适合需要更高精度的应用场景。
通过以上两种方法,我们可以轻松地生成所需的随机数,让我们的程序更加灵活和强大!🚀🌈